SQL Server connectivity Issue

  • I am able to connect the server but not to the SSMS. getting the below error:

    "

    The client was unable to establish a connection because of an error during connection initialization process before login. Possible causes include the following: the client tried to connect to an unsupported version of SQL Server; the server was too busy to accept new connections; or there was a resource limitation (insufficient memory or maximum allowed connections) on the server. (provider: TCP Provider, error: 0 - An existing connection was forcibly closed by the remote host.) (Microsoft SQL Server, Error: 10054)"

    To fix it :

    I have done some changes in system registry..

    from the path... \System\CurrentControlSet\Control\Lsa\Kerberos\Parameters

    --Added the following registry value:

    Name: MaxTokenSize

    Data type: REG_DWORD

    Radix: Decimal

    Value: 48000

    --Rebooted server

    and it resolves the issue for me..

    BUT it is happening weekly basis..

    and every time server restart resolves the issue.

    CAN ANYBODY HELP TO FIX THE ISSUE PERMANENTLY..

    Details :

    SQL Server 2005-- SP4 -- Standard Edition (64-bit)

    MS Windows Server 2003 R2-- SP2-- Standard x64 Edition

    RAM: 16 GB

  • Thanks for the reply.

    Yesterday it happened... SQL was not allowed any new connections..but it was showing 99 % CPU usage by SQL.

    we restarted the server ... and server is back. I found the error "LazyWriter: warning<c/> no free buffers found"

    I think the Memory is not sufficient for the Environment or else we need to lock the memory by assigning the Lock pages in memory user right to the user account that is used as the startup account of the SQL Server service.I will try if it happened next time.. or we will increase the RAM

  • hello,

    I think you need to check ,How much memory does server have? How did you config memory in sql?

    and due to issues with memory configuration. Two quick things to check:

    1. SQL Server 'max server memory' is set to an optimal value

    2. SQL Server service account has "Lock pages in Memory" rights
